![]() Fragment 2 mightĬontain some TextView s and ImageViews showing some text and images.įor More detials i recommend you to explore this book : Professional Android Application Development book reviews you will find all the details about fragments in the page 69 with code examples. Fragment 1 might contain a ListView showing a list of book titles. For example, Figure 2-15 shows twoįragments. Fragments are always embedded in an activity. You create fragments to contain views, just likeĪctivities. Think of a fragment as another form of activity. In Android 3.0 and later, these mini-activities are known as fragments. During runtime, anĪctivity can contain one or more of these mini-activities, depending on the screen orientation in A betterĪpproach is to have “mini-activities,” each containing its own set of views. Make full use of the increased space, resulting in complex changes to the view hierarchy. Because the screen is much bigger, all the views in an activity must be arranged to The image sizes and formats that can be used with each source vary, and should be checked. Several Android media API classes accept Surface objects as targets to render to, including MediaPlayer, MediaCodec, and RenderScript Allocations. However, when an activity is displayed in a large-screen device, such as on a tablet, it is somewhat The ImageReader class allows direct application access to image data rendered into a Surface. The activity is essentially a container for views. That make up the user interface of an application. ![]() If I start querying the database once I have at least 4 characters, I could end up with searching 20 times.Īn activity typically fi lls the entire screen, displaying the various views The textbox could hold any number of characters from 4 to 24. (Please note that the barcode is scanned in, not typed in.) I use the timer approach, but find out the tick function is called 11 times. NET - Textbox control - wait till user is done typing I have searched the web and find out this: That means the database is searched for more than 11 times. In this case, its a bad effect: if you listen for long enough you will likely feel. However, as the barcode is long (some 11 characters), the TextChanged() function is called more than 11 times. Shepard Madness is an example of a sound that can physically affect you. Here is the design:Ģ) After scanning, automatically call web service to search the database.ģ) If found data, display in a table below. This option may be re-enabled by the project by placing a file with the name ".I am writing an application. NOTE: As of directory index display has been disabled by default. Contact the project administrators of this project via email (see the upper right-hand corner of the Project Summary page for their usernames) at you are a maintainer of this web content, please refer to the Site Documentation regarding web services for further assistance.Contact the project via their designated support resources.Tone Generator Extension by Juan Antonio - link. If this is a severe or recurring/persistent problem, please do one of the following, and provide the error text (numbered 1 through 7, above): This could be used for example to store the location data in a MySQL database or to. This issue should be reported to the -hosted project (not to ). Reporting this problem: The problem you have encountered is with a project web site hosted by. URL path: /reference/android/media/ToneGenerator.html An error has been encountered in accessing this page.Ģ.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|